IT Network & Telecommunications Administrator
Salary: £36,000 - £48,000 per annum (depending on experience)
Hours: Monday to Friday, 8.30am - 5.30pm (40 hour week)
Location: Southampton office based
Please note that Garmin do not offer sponsorship, all applicants must have Right to Work status for UK.
Purpose of the Role
Responsible for managing technology efficiently using tools and scripting. Organizes, leads, and coordinates IT components to ensure system integrity and performance.
* Designs and develops solutions to meet business needs or improve Garmin’s network and telecommunications systems
* Performs cost analyses and vendor comparisons for projects to ensure efficiency and cost-effectiveness
* Continuously develops expertise in current and emerging network & telecommunications technologies
* Communicates effectively regarding system operations and changes
* Adheres to SOX, PCI, and other regulatory standards
* Monitors network capacity, redundancy, and health to prevent issues
* Ensures security requirements are met or exceeded
* Follows standards and procedures proficiently
* Communicates effectively in team or departmental settings
* Aligns work with Garmin’s Mission Statement and Quality Policy
* Mentors less experienced IT Administrators
* Provides reliable solutions through sound problem-solving, root cause analysis, and corrective actions
* Plans and performs minor system upgrades
* Uses tools and scripting for efficient management
* Makes component improvement recommendations
* Identifies system interdependencies
* Coordinates cross-team changes
* Participates in system and application roadmap planning
* Leads meetings with IT users
* Adapts to change and welcomes feedback
* Maintains appropriate security access levels
Education & Experience
* Bachelor’s Degree in Computer Science, IT, MIS, Business, or related field, or 2 years relevant experience, or an equivalent combination
* Ability to solve moderately complex technical problems independently
* Experience in implementing technology solutions successfully
* Strong communication skills in small team settings
* Effective documentation and organizational skills
* Deep understanding of IT Infrastructure, including Telephony systems like Avaya, SIP, and Microsoft Teams Voice
